Job Details

  • Regional Education in Emergencies (EiE) Technical Advisor will drive the quality, accountability and timeliness of humanitarian responses and contribute to emergency preparedness in the region.

  • Regional technical experts use their in-depth contextual understanding, technical expertise and relationship building skills to provide a critical link between Save the Children’s global and country level technical work in both sudden onset emergencies and protracted crises, strengthening our technical offer at the regional level.

  • They play a strong role in regional capacity building efforts, mentoring and building networks across country office (CO) technical experts, and foster cross-CO learning on humanitarian response

  • They support regional advocacy and influencing and drive regional strategic partnerships for learning and new business development

  • They provide quality assurance and demand driven technical assistance (TA) to COs across the humanitarian education portfolio, in line with regional priorities and together with other regional staff supporting emergency response and education programming.

  • A core function is to ensure that our Education Cluster Co-leadership role is developed and maintained in the region. .
